PEO IWS HOSTS OPEN ARCHITECTURE INDUSTRY DAY

The U.S. Navy issued the following press release:

The Navy's Program Executive Office for Integrated Warfare Systems (PEO IWS) Future Combat Systems Open Architecture Program Office sponsored an Industry Day here Feb. 14.

The event was held to discuss implementation of the Navy's open architecture programs with industry partners.

"The Navy has a shipbuilding plan in place, and we need to develop combat systems that are capable and affordable to support it. The open architecture enterprise initiative will allow the Navy to rapidly upgrade systems as new technologies develop and do so at an affordable cost," said Capt.
